ARLINGTON, Texas (AP) _ Adrian Beltre singled home Shin-Soo Choo with the game
winner in the ninth inning, and the Texas Rangers saved a run on a successful
replay challenge in a 3-2 victory against the Philadelphia Phillies on Tuesday
night.
Choo, who also scored the tying run in the seventh, reached base for the fourth
time on a walk to start the ninth against Phillies left-hander Mario Hollands
(0-1), who was making his major league debut.
After Elvis Andrus’ sacrifice bunt and walk to Prince Fielder, new Phillies
manager Ryne Sandberg went to right-hander B.J. Rosenberg. Beltre singled softly
left right-center field, scoring Choo without a throw.
New Texas closer Joakim Soria got the win with a perfect ninth inning in his
season debut.
